A complete roofing substitute is simply what it seems like: total. Unlike re-roofing, which includes laying down a brand-new layer of roof shingles on top of your old roof material, a full roofing substitute includes detaching every layer of your roof covering and replacing it. This is why some firms call it a "tear-off" roofing system.


They imitate a suit of shield, losing water and debris, and keeping all the underlying layers of your roof covering dry and free from damage. Asphalt roof shingles are the most common kind of roof covering tile utilized on domestic homes, however you have several roof choices to pick from. Decking: The decking is a considerable layer of protection for your home, commonly consisting of a collection of level boards affixed to the joists or trusses.


Siding Installation NebraskaCommercial Roofing Nebraska
Underlayment: This crucial layer goes in-between the outdoor decking and the tiles. Underlayment is a water-proof or waterproof layer connected straight to the roofing system deck, and provides an extra level of protection from severe climate. Blinking: A thin but essential roof covering component, blinking is used to route water far from susceptible areas of the roof covering, specifically where a section of roof fulfills a vertical surface area like a wall surface or smokeshaft.
